Amid a price hike on the Pixel 11 series, Google has delivered some solid trade-in values across the board on all four phones, including some pretty great values for older generations too.
As RAMageddon continues to impact the entire tech marketplace – thanks AI companies – prices continue to go up. On the Pixel 11 series, that comes in the form of higher starting prices (and higher base storage) on the Pixel 11 and Pixel 11 Pro, with $100 price hikes to the Pro XL and Pro Fold devices.
Seemingly to soften the blow, Google has some excellent trade-in values this year.
For Pixel 10 last year, Google Store’s trade-in values (in the US) maxed out at around $800. This year, that number is $1,000. Of course, you’ll need a heavyweight trade-in to get that full value. Specifically, either the Pixel 10 Pro Fold or Galaxy Z Fold 7. Trade-in values are also capped at the value of the device, so an $899 Pixel 11 will net you at maximum of $899 in value.
The good news here is that there are some very good values for very old hardware hidden within the crowd here.
Trading in a Pixel 4a to a Pixel 11, for instance, gives $150 for that outdated and impossible-to-use smartphone. Google will also give you $200 for trading in an iPhone 11, a 2019 release that’s likely to stop getting updates soon. While there are no crazy standouts as we’ve seen in some past years, trade-in values as a whole are solid, and there are actually some decent prices going around for older generations of Pixel, Galaxy, and Apple hardware.

In the UK, our Damien Wilde noticed that a Galaxy S10+ trade-in is worth €455 – it’s just $30 in the States. So, definitely worth a look there.
You can also get good Pixel 11 trade-in deals at Amazon and Best Buy.
Amazon is throwing in $250 on top of virtually any trade-in, boosting some devices above Google’s offers, while Best Buy is offering up to $1,000 with gift cards of varying values depending on what device you purchase. Hit up the links below for more.
